41
counseling for levothyroxine
-take with water at least 30 minutes before breakfast to increase absorption -take same way every da -take >4 hours apart from antacids and iron -may take several weeks to see symptoms improve
42
counseling for tamsulosin
-take 30 minutes after the same meal each day to increase absorption -orthostatic hypotension -headache -dizziness
43
counseling for tolterodine
-constipation -dry mouth -headache
44
counseling for donepezil
-nausea -diarrhea -risk of stomach bleed with NSAIDs -prolonged QT interval
45
counseling for alendronate
-take 30 minutes before breakfast to increase absorption -ensure adequate Ca and Vit D intake -take with 8oz of water and remain upright for 30 minutes -report heartburn or bone pain to physician
46
counseling for allopurinol
-report rash to prescriber if it occurs -may cause nausea and/or diarrhea -gout attacks may be more frequent in early therapy
47
counseling for oseltamivir
-nausea/vomiting -headache -does not replace vaccine -must initiate within 48 hours of onset symptoms
48
counseling for ferrous sulfate
-best absorbed on empty stomach, but take with food if upset stomach occurs -separate 2 hours before or after other medications -black stools -constipation common
49
counseling for sumatriptin
-tingling, dizziness common -avoid if history of CV disease -overuse (more than 10 days per month) may worsen or increase frequency of headaches
50
counseling for tadalafil
-do not take more than once daily -avoid alcohol due to risk of low blood pressure -avoid grapefruit juice or lower dose/frequency of tadalafil use -headache and flushing -report sudden loss of hearing or vision and discontinue
